Think Agents plans ThinkOS beta next month

Think Agents has announced that the public beta of ThinkOS is on track to launch next month. The platform is a model-agnostic, private-data, and locally-hosted AI agent operating system designed for users to coordinate autonomous agents while ensuring complete data ownership.

// ANALYSIS

Local-first AI agent runtimes are the next frontier for user privacy, but success depends on how easily non-technical users can run local models on consumer-grade hardware. By storing memories locally as plain Markdown files and supporting model-agnostic agent coordination across devices, ThinkOS addresses security concerns while targeting broad adoption.
